Essential Functions:
  • Provide direct personal care to terminally ill patients
  • Assist with personal hygiene, grooming, and toileting
  • Support safe mobility, including use of walkers and wheelchairs
  • Help with meal preparation, feeding, and light housekeeping
  • Observe and report changes in the patient's physical or mental condition
  • Offer emotional and psychological support to patients and families
  • Maintain accurate and timely documentation of visits
  • Attend team meetings and participate in Quality Improvement (QI) activities
  • Practice infection control and follow safety protocols at all times
About You:

Qualifications– What You'll Bring:

  • Active CNA license in the state of employment (Required)
  • Current CPR certification (Required)
  • Driver's license and reliable vehicle with insurance (Required)
  • Six (6) months of direct patient care experience (Required)
  • Comfortable working in home settings, hospice facilities, or long-term care environments
  • Demonstrated compassion, patience, and ability to handle emotional situations
  • Willingness to work independently and adapt to changing patient needs

Preferred Background (Not Required):

  • Experience in home health, hospice, palliative care, or oncology
  • Prior roles in hospital nursing, ICU, geriatrics, med-surg, ER, telemetry, or nursing homes
  • Exposure to end-of-life care, wound care, or admissions support
